 Sppedometer stopped working while driving. driving about 70 when the speedometer suddently went up to 120. when i came to a stop and turned off enging the speedometer still reads anywhere from 50 to 60 mph (while in park). *tr

 While driving the speedometer will stop descending at a speed and when the driver accelerates, the needle will respond as though the sticking point were the speed of deceleration and continue rising from there until the needle is over past the last listed speed on the face of the ipc. it occurs about once every two weeks and when it occurs it is impossible to know what the speed of the vehicle is. so far, it is possible to correct the problem by letting the vehicle sit, sometimes overnight is necessary, and start the vehicle and then shut it off. this drops the speedometer needle about 5mph. the driver must continue to do this until the needle has gone from the black face of the ipc to the zero mark on the panel. *tr
